Tips for 1 hr Connections
Since PEN has only one terminal, orient yourself early — signage clearly separates domestic and international flows but the checkpoints add time.
If your connection crosses from international to domestic, budget extra time for immigration queues, which can be slow depending on staffing.
Food and lounge options are limited, so don't expect to linger — grab a meal quickly if you have a longer layover.
AirAsia and Malaysia Airlines dominate the schedule, so check if your itinerary is on a single ticket, as separate tickets carry more risk here given limited rebooking staff.
Immigration and customs can bottleneck during late morning and early evening banks of arrivals, so build in buffer time then.

Getting Between Concourses
PEN operates from a single terminal building with domestic and international sections separated by immigration and security checkpoints. Passengers connecting from international to domestic (or vice versa) must clear immigration, while domestic-to-domestic transfers typically just require a walk through the shared departure area without re-screening.
